Its been a few days since I have posted on my blog, I apologize for the lapse. I have been actively involved with providing assistance to the victims of the Earthquake. Generating funds and Mashallah through our Donate a Dollar Campaign have collected upwards of $2200 in the 1 1/2 week of operation. Jazak’Allah to all those who donated.
In the effort I have launched a campaign to raise funds for the AFID (Armed Forces Institute of Dentistry, Pindi) which is the HQ for all Maxillofacial Surgery in the Earthquake. A number of volunteer surgeons from all over Pakistan have gone to the center to do surgeries round-the-clock to save lives. The AFID has provided me a list of items that it needs URGENTLY. So here in Karachi, I have organized a campaign amongst dentist “Dentist for Earthquake Relief – Building Bridge, Filling Cavities and Now Saving Lives”. Inshallah soon we will donate a handsome amount to AFID- Inshallah.
